About
Ross Jewell served at the University of Northern Iowa from 1951 to 1985. He began as an Instructor (1951–1953) and later held the rank of Assistant Professor (1954–1969) before advancing to Associate Professor (1969–1985). His roles included administrative responsibilities as Administrative Assistant for Composition from 1963 to 1968. His work spanned departments evolving from English and Speech to English Language and Literature.
He took extended leaves, including disability leave from 1980 to 1983 and a final leave in 1984–1985. His expertise centered on English language pedagogy, composition, and literature.
